Fishing tournament
The Georgia State Parks and Historic Sites is holding the 12th annual Parent-Child Fishing Tournament on Saturday on the banks of Mistletoe State Park, Appling. Registration is from 7 to 10 a.m. and weigh-in at 3 p.m.
A $5 entry fee per family is required. All fish count in weighing. All prizes, trophies and awards will be provided. The grand prize is a two-night stay in Mistletoe State Park.
Junior Ranger Program
Mistletoe State Park will host the Junior Ranger Program Tuesday and Wednesday from 9:30 a.m. to 1:30 p.m. The program, for ages 6-12, introduce children to Georgia's natural, cultural and recreational resources.
Junior Rangers take hikes, see live snakes and learn about Georgia's wildlife. They receive a Junior Ranger handbook and complete activities throughout it. When completed, children receive a Junior Ranger patch.
